# Runbook: Hunting leaked file descriptors in Quillgate

When the `fd_open` gauge climbs steadily between deploys, suspect a leak rather than load. First confirm on a single pod: exec in and count entries under `/proc/1/fd`, noting how many are sockets in CLOSE_WAIT versus regular files. Capture two snapshots ten minutes apart before restarting anything — we need the delta for the postmortem. Reproduce locally with the Marbury load harness, which requires the service running with the following configuration values.

settings of yagep-bajog:
[istdor]
port = 4000
region = south-2
host = istdor.qorvelcorp.internal
timeout_ms = 5000
retries = 5

Hiring Freeze — Westfold Logistics Division (Managers Only)

Effective immediately, all open requisitions in the Westfold Logistics division are paused. Backfills require written approval from Director Annika Tolvane. Contractor extensions beyond 60 days are also suspended. The freeze does not apply to the Harrowgate depot safety roles. Department heads should brief their teams using the standard talking points before month-end.

board note of fahag-tajop: The eastern region missed its Julix quota by 44.0 percent last quarter. Ralionax Holdings plans to lower the Druath list price by 61.8 percent in March. The board signed off on a budget of $295.0 million for Project Gilath. The renewal with Ruswynix Systems closes at $274.5 million a year, 17.0 percent above the last contract.

New team members: this step provisions the master key protecting the Taxgrid rate-lookup cache. Because stale or tampered tax rates could propagate to every checkout flow at Orvella, the cache is encrypted and signed at rest. Verify that the ceremony witness from the Calloway compliance group has countersigned the attendance sheet, and that the hardware module shows a green provisioning light. Do not proceed if either check fails. When prompted by the module, enter the recovery passphrase below.

unlock words, kajeg-fahif: holmir-casael-novdor